Second off, FAQ:

What base can I expect out of training?

This is a moving target, PHX, LAX, or SEA are all achievable out of training or close as of this writing*. PHX is certainly a lot smaller but an easy commute to LAX if you have to, no one base seems much more senior than any of the others. LAX is probably the most 'junior' but it seems that most have their base of choice out of training or within a month.

What is reserve time?

... also a moving target. Current hires can expect 2-3 months of reserve, but be prepared to sit up to 6 months just realistically if hiring were to slow/pause, or if the floor for FO's goes back to 75 and there's less lines, depending on your base, we don't wanna hear your whining, many people here spent years on reserve at other carriers. But it seems reasonable to expect at least 6 months, with the possibility of less or more, that's regional life!

What is upgrade time?
Seems to hold pretty steady at about ~2 to 2.25 years** on average, might be less for some with the big gap in hiring, but those captains have already been hired. Some CA already on property are going to have waited 2.5 years. Bottom line, this place is always hemorrhaging pilots to the majors, and we don't have lifers. Everybody just wants out.
